Three Revenue Measures Delayed until July 2012
June 1, 2012
The Ministry of Finance and Planning wishes to advise that the announced revenue measures as it relates to the GCT regime on Electricity, the termination costs for telephone calls and the modified asset tax for financial institutions and security dealers have been delayed until the month of July 2012. The new effective dates are as follows:
- The measure relating to GCT on Electricity will take effect on July 1, 2012,
- Adjustments to the termination fee structure as it relates to mobile to mobile and mobile to land termination will take effect July 15, 2012, and
- The modified asset tax for financial institutions and security dealers will take effect July 1, 2012
Dr. the Honourable Peter Phillips, Minister of Finance and Planning, announced the measures as a part of his opening budget presentation on Thursday, May 24, 2012.
